What is the meaning of the name Dalmacio ?

The baby name Dalmacio is a boy name 3 syllables long and is pronounced dahl-MAH-syo.

Dalmacio is Spanish in Origin.

The name Dalmacio is of Spanish origin, derived from the Greek name Dalmatios, meaning "of Dalmatia." It is a masculine name typically associated with males. Dalmacio is pronounced as dal-MAH-syo and consists of three syllables.

Currently, the name Dalmacio is not very popular and is considered quite rare. It is more commonly found in Spanish-speaking countries such as Spain, Mexico, and Argentina. Despite its limited popularity, Dalmacio carries a sense of uniqueness and tradition.

What is the origin of the name Dalmacio?

The name Dalmacio has its roots in Latin, derived from the name Dalmatius. It is often associated with the region of Dalmatia in Croatia, which has historical ties to the Roman Empire. This origin gives the name a rich cultural and historical background.

Is there a specific meaning associated with the name Dalmacio?

The name Dalmacio is often interpreted to mean 'from Dalmatia' or 'of Dalmatia.' This geographical association ties the name to a specific region, giving it a sense of place and identity. Such meanings can resonate with individuals who have connections to that area.
